Spain’s Commitment to Water Security in Morocco
In a notable initiative aimed at enhancing water security, Spain has unveiled plans for a €340 million investment dedicated to the establishment of a desalination facility in Casablanca, Morocco. This ambitious project emerges amid escalating challenges related to climate change and water scarcity,particularly affecting arid regions. The desalination plant is anticipated to provide clean drinking water for millions and support agricultural endeavors,reflecting the deepening collaboration between Spain and Morocco in tackling urgent environmental concerns. As both countries confront the realities of drought and effective water management strategies,this partnership not only signifies a commitment to sustainable development but also emphasizes the critical role of cross-border cooperation in addressing regional issues. Impact of Spain’s Investment on casablanca’s Water Supply
Spain’s substantial financial commitment towards developing the Casablanca Desalination Plant represents a proactive approach to combatting severe water shortages in Morocco.This strategic move underscores Spain’s dedication to fostering international partnerships while aiming to bolster regional water security. The facility is projected to be crucial in supplying potable water as Casablanca grapples with an increasing population that intensifies pressure on its current freshwater resources.
The design of this desalination project incorporates state-of-the-art technologies alongside sustainable practices aimed at ensuring operational efficiency while being environmentally conscious. Notable features include:
- Advanced Technology: Employing reverse osmosis techniques for optimal purification.
- Adaptability: Designed with scalability options to accommodate future demand as urban growth continues.
- Sustainability Focus: Strategies implemented are intended to minimize ecological disruption and enhance marine ecosystems.
This investment is expected not only to drive technological progress but also stimulate socio-economic growth within the region by creating job opportunities and supporting local industries—laying groundwork for a more sustainable future.
Broader Economic and Environmental Benefits of the Desalination Project
The €340 million allocation towards constructing the Casablanca desalination Plant stands as a pivotal moment for Morocco’s approach toward managing its freshwater resources effectively.With rising demands driven by population increases and agricultural needs, desalinated seawater presents itself as a viable alternative solution that can alleviate reliance on conventional sources—potentially lessening drought impacts that have historically affected this area substantially. Given that Morocco ranks among one of the most arid nations globally, such initiatives could greatly enhance overall water security while together boosting agricultural productivity essential for rural livelihoods.
Econonomically speaking, this desalination venture will generate numerous job opportunities during both construction phases and ongoing operations once it becomes functional. It is projected that local businesses will benefit from increased demand through procurement processes involving materials and services necessary for plant operation. Furthermore, stabilizing access to reliable freshwater could catalyze economic activities across various sectors including tourism and manufacturing—leading toward greater economic diversification within Moroccan society.
